switch back from golang.org/x/sys/execabs to os/exec (go1.19)
This is effectively a revert of 2ac9968401, which
switched from os/exec to the golang.org/x/sys/execabs package to mitigate
security issues (mainly on Windows) with lookups resolving to binaries in the
current directory.

from the go1.19 release notes https://go.dev/doc/go1.19#os-exec-path

> ## PATH lookups
>
> Command and LookPath no longer allow results from a PATH search to be found
> relative to the current directory. This removes a common source of security
> problems but may also break existing programs that depend on using, say,
> exec.Command("prog") to run a binary named prog (or, on Windows, prog.exe) in
> the current directory. See the os/exec package documentation for information
> about how best to update such programs.
>
> On Windows, Command and LookPath now respect the NoDefaultCurrentDirectoryInExePath
> environment variable, making it possible to disable the default implicit search
> of “.” in PATH lookups on Windows systems.

package sys
import (
"errors"
"fmt"
"os"
"os/exec"
"testing"
"time"
"github.com/containerd/containerd/v2/pkg/userns"
"github.com/stretchr/testify/assert"
"github.com/stretchr/testify/require"
)
func TestSetPositiveOomScoreAdjustment(t *testing.T) {
// Setting a *positive* OOM score adjust does not require privileged
_, adjustment, err := adjustOom(123)
assert.NoError(t, err)
assert.EqualValues(t, adjustment, 123)
}
func TestSetNegativeOomScoreAdjustmentWhenPrivileged(t *testing.T) {
if !runningPrivileged() || userns.RunningInUserNS() {
t.Skip("requires root and not running in user namespace")
return
}
_, adjustment, err := adjustOom(-123)
assert.NoError(t, err)
assert.EqualValues(t, adjustment, -123)
}
func TestSetNegativeOomScoreAdjustmentWhenUnprivilegedHasNoEffect(t *testing.T) {
if runningPrivileged() && !userns.RunningInUserNS() {
t.Skip("needs to be run as non-root or in user namespace")
return
}
initial, adjustment, err := adjustOom(-123)
assert.NoError(t, err)
assert.EqualValues(t, adjustment, initial)
}
func TestSetOOMScoreBoundaries(t *testing.T) {
err := SetOOMScore(0, OOMScoreAdjMax+1)
require.NotNil(t, err)
assert.Contains(t, err.Error(), fmt.Sprintf("value out of range (%d): OOM score must be between", OOMScoreAdjMax+1))
err = SetOOMScore(0, OOMScoreAdjMin-1)
require.NotNil(t, err)
assert.Contains(t, err.Error(), fmt.Sprintf("value out of range (%d): OOM score must be between", OOMScoreAdjMin-1))
_, adjustment, err := adjustOom(OOMScoreAdjMax)
assert.NoError(t, err)
assert.EqualValues(t, adjustment, OOMScoreAdjMax)
score, err := GetOOMScoreAdj(os.Getpid())
assert.NoError(t, err)
if score == OOMScoreAdjMin {
// We won't be able to set the score lower than the parent process. This
// could also be tested if the parent process does not have a oom-score-adj
// set, but GetOOMScoreAdj does not distinguish between "not set" and
// "score is set, but zero".
_, adjustment, err = adjustOom(OOMScoreAdjMin)
assert.NoError(t, err)
assert.EqualValues(t, adjustment, OOMScoreAdjMin)
}
}
func adjustOom(adjustment int) (int, int, error) {
cmd := exec.Command("sleep", "100")
if err := cmd.Start(); err != nil {
return 0, 0, err
}
defer cmd.Process.Kill()
pid, err := waitForPid(cmd.Process)
if err != nil {
return 0, 0, err
}
initial, err := GetOOMScoreAdj(pid)
if err != nil {
return 0, 0, err
}
if err := SetOOMScore(pid, adjustment); err != nil {
return 0, 0, err
}
adj, err := GetOOMScoreAdj(pid)
return initial, adj, err
}
func waitForPid(process *os.Process) (int, error) {
c := make(chan int, 1)
go func() {
for {
pid := process.Pid
if pid != 0 {
c <- pid
}
}
}()
select {
case pid := <-c:
return pid, nil
case <-time.After(10 * time.Second):
return 0, errors.New("process did not start in 10 seconds")
}
}
